Output 882471514623abf8b51996b95b7a7ad92e3d8cc166f327bbed0a53c1e5a6cc20:1

value
5673348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f747c4e565d1ec3a059bafb2359a54b225218539 OP_EQUAL
address
3QEWoXpHzGDPdVxDe4debNiJBmAkgE9ZXN
transaction
882471514623abf8b51996b95b7a7ad92e3d8cc166f327bbed0a53c1e5a6cc20
confirmations
312776
spent
true